I have tried to download and de-arc the PROJECTOR series of
video animation files. Several things happened strangely. I was
assured in one of the Readme files that I would get a projector
icon to click on while I was in the Workbench. I didn't. I did,
however, get a file called Projector.in. I RENAME'd this to
Projector.info and poof! the icon popped up. After that, the
program seemed to have all the modules necessary to work.
–
The file for the SOAP animation wasn't so fortunate. After de-
arcing I got a series of files called "p1" thru "p15". Two files
that also popped up during de-arc were "Ex.me" and another very
similar. The Readme file assures me that you have to execute Ex.me
to "rename all the files". DOS, however, had very different ideas.
IT insists that it was "UNABLE TO LOAD EX.ME: FILE IS NOT AN
OBJECT MODULE". Both files do this.
–
I'm dead in the water. I have absolutely no idea what the
system wants me to do. Projector will not run the p1 thru p15
files in their present form.
